I’ve gotten to know about Inglot through Gaylee. She’s got a small trio eyeshadow from her friend in Dubai, so she asked me if I could get my husband find it since he was coming home anyway. So we sent him a photo of what she has got and luckily my husband was able to locate Inglot shop in Bahrain and bought 2 small trio eyeshadow, in green and brown shade.
I kept the green one since I still do not have this shade and gave the brown one to Gaylee.
I love its smooth feeling while applying. The receipt shows BD7 each so it’s about Php800 in Philippine currency. Quite costly for this size but worth it, that’s why I’ve just told my husband to get me a palette next time, in earth colors. He’s okay with it for as long as he won’t have a hard time getting the colors that I wanted.
